Transaction 26e5e79c2a40383a01f2a589680a28d552d9eee1b9ef42eb4a75801a4e9f37b7

1 Input
2 Outputs
  • 26e5e79c2a40383a01f2a589680a28d552d9eee1b9ef42eb4a75801a4e9f37b7:0
  • value  30498328
    address  3KvHcR14XCxu947vwkYK6p1nQmnRyvpnYz
  • 26e5e79c2a40383a01f2a589680a28d552d9eee1b9ef42eb4a75801a4e9f37b7:1
  • value  200640
    address  35KJ8SRFwAD1mvSQtGvtfQAQYUfyTdTeFe